EXPLORING THE ESSENTIAL QUESTION

"What must I do to be at peace, so that I can live presently, and die gracefully?"

An In-Person Retreat
with
Rachel Gaunt

January 10 — 11, 2025

This essential question seems to resonate with everyone, no matter what age or stage they are at.

 

However, it has special resonance for those of us in our later years.

 

Each person will naturally have their own personal response to the question. That is to be expected. 

 

But often the themes are universal.

For example: 

- What does it mean to be at peace with myself?

 

- What do I still long to do, or say, or be?

 

- What relationships in my life are full, complete and up to date?

Are there any that feel like they need attention and healing?

 

- What things are still unsaid or undone? 

Presented as a weekend retreat, this retreat opens a space for people to identify something important that they want to attend to.
